Furnace Creek Campground

Dogs are allowed at Furnace Creek Campground, but they must be kept on a leash no longer than 6 feet when outside your vehicle. For more information on pet restrictions, please call (760) 786-2441.

Description

Furnace Creek Campground is located in Death Valley National Park. The campground is open year-round, with 136 sites. Fees range from $12-18 per night. Water, flushing toilets, picnic tables and fire pits are available.

    Not recommended.

    While I love Death Valley NP and all the sites it’s not dog friendly. All the sites and trails specifically state no dogs allowed. it can get hot - even in the winter months so leaving the puppy at the campsite is not an option. No dog runs or parks.
